Key Learning Pillars Addressed

Software Development Lifecycle (SDLC): Explore the iterative and sequential phases of software creation, from initial conception through deployment and maintenance, with questions designed to test understanding of various models (Waterfall, V-Model, Spiral, etc.) and their applicability.
Object-Oriented Design (OOD) & Design Patterns: Master the principles of object-oriented programming and delve into the practical application of established design patterns (e.g., Singleton, Factory, Observer, Decorator) for building scalable, maintainable, and robust software systems.
Software Testing Strategies: Understand the different levels and types of testing, including unit, integration, system, and acceptance testing, along with test-driven development (TDD) and behavior-driven development (BDD) principles.
Agile Methodologies: Gain proficiency in Agile frameworks like Scrum and Kanban, focusing on iterative development, collaboration, continuous delivery, and responding to change.
System Design Fundamentals: Grasp the foundational concepts involved in designing complex software systems, including scalability, reliability, performance, and maintainability.
Data Structures and Algorithms (Conceptual): While not a primary focus, the pack implicitly tests the understanding of how data structures and algorithms influence design choices and efficiency within the broader SE context.
Version Control Systems (Conceptual): Understand the importance and basic principles of using version control (like Git) for collaborative software development.
Requirements Engineering: Learn about eliciting, analyzing, specifying, and managing software requirements effectively.
Software Quality Assurance: Understand the principles and practices that ensure software meets defined quality standards.
Code Quality and Maintainability: Explore concepts related to writing clean, readable, and maintainable code that facilitates long-term project success.
